About Dr. Daniel LeGoff

Dr. Daniel LeGoff is a licensed psychologist in Florida with PsyPact authorization to provide telehealth services in participating states. With 27 years of clinical experience, he has worked with individuals and families facing a wide range of complex challenges, including interpersonal conflicts, neurodiversity, mood and social difficulties, communication concerns, brain and spinal cord injury, employment and disability issues, chronic health conditions, and stress.

His clinical stance is pragmatic and strength-focused, emphasizing interpersonal synergy both within the therapeutic relationship and in clients' everyday lives. He frames therapy as a collaborative process that begins with self-awareness and acceptance and moves toward creative engagement in meaningful life experiences. Could Virtual Therapy Be a Good Fit?

Many people wonder whether online therapy can truly help. For many common concerns - such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, and navigating life changes - online therapy has been shown to be just as effective as traditional in-person sessions.

One of the clearest benefits is flexibility. Individuals can connect with therapists in the way that best fits their needs and schedules by using video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or in-app messaging. This range of options can make it easier to integrate therapy into a busy life.

Therapists who offer remote services are licensed professionals, and clients have the option to change providers if they seek a different fit. For many people, online therapy provides an accessible, effective way to work on personal goals and challenges while maintaining the convenience of remote sessions.
